Sietske Grijseels is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biotechnology and Pharmacology. According to data from OpenAlex, Sietske Grijseels has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 374 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Biotechnology and 4 papers in Pharmacology. Recurrent topics in Sietske Grijseels’s work include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(4 papers), Microbial Metabolism and Applications (4 papers) and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(3 papers). Sietske Grijseels is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(4 papers), Microbial Metabolism and Applications (4 papers) and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(3 papers). Sietske Grijseels collaborates with scholars based in Denmark, Sweden and The Netherlands. Sietske Grijseels's co-authors include Mhairi Workman, Jens Nielsen, Jens Nielsen, Kristian Fog Nielsen, Jens C. Frisvad, Boyang Ji, Sylvain Prigent, Jacques Dainat, Elke Nevoigt and Jack T. Pronk and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Journal of Chromatography A and Nature Microbiology.
